Do you ever break into a cold sweat thinking about how the gorgeous woman who adores you will become in pregnancy a squashy bag of hormones bearing no resemblance to your sweet-natured other half? About how all those broken nights will affect your work? About how exactly you're going to deal with toddler and teenage tantrums, the demands on your wallet - and most importantly, how you'll answer That question about where they came from? Not Rocket Science: Dads is a comprehensive, witty and informative guide to help every man through those moments of doubt, from getting pregnant to looking after the expectant mother, the baby's first years, through coping with teenagers and the life changes that take place once the kids have grown up and left home. Packed with advice from men from all backgrounds who've survived dad-dom, as well as experts in the fields of sex and parenting, this book is small enough to fit in your pocket and designed for easy reference, so you can stop every worrying niggle, every hard-to-solve problem and every moment of fear and stay top of the Dad Class at all times!
